Hyperledger composer 调试事务代码

Hyperledger composer 调试事务代码,hyperledger-composer,Hyperledger Composer,我一直在问自己,是否有一种简单的方法可以调试事务的JavaScript代码。JS已经有了成熟的调试器,问题只是如何轻松地将其绑定到容器中运行的代码。有人有线索吗?--Thx.调试事务代码的最简单方法之一是将业务网络部署到嵌入式结构中,这基本上意味着您的代码可以像任何其他NodeJS应用程序一样运行,您可以使用节点调试器逐步调试代码,甚至可以使用简单的console.log语句(如果足够的话) 要深入了解如何实现这一点,请查看此处的代码:更新链接 这是示例网络单元测试的beforeach方法,您

我一直在问自己,是否有一种简单的方法可以调试事务的JavaScript代码。JS已经有了成熟的调试器,问题只是如何轻松地将其绑定到容器中运行的代码。有人有线索吗?--Thx.

调试事务代码的最简单方法之一是将业务网络部署到嵌入式结构中,这基本上意味着您的代码可以像任何其他NodeJS应用程序一样运行,您可以使用节点调试器逐步调试代码,甚至可以使用简单的console.log语句(如果足够的话)

要深入了解如何实现这一点,请查看此处的代码:更新链接

这是示例网络单元测试的beforeach方法,您将看到,它将网络部署到“嵌入式”结构

然后,代码继续执行测试,包括在嵌入式businessNetworkConnection上调用
submitTransaction
API,从而使嵌入式结构评估事务脚本代码

因此,这一切都发生在一个单一节点的应用程序,更容易调试


HTH

Thx,我来试试。唉。。。链接不见了,作曲家正在捣乱我